tumefaciens Smith and Townsend 1907 Lieske 1928PosilannyaVikishovishe Agrobacterium tumefaciensVikividi Agrobacterium tumefaciensITIS 967928NCBI 358Agrobacterium tumefaciens vid gram negativnih obligatno aerobnih palichkovidnih gruntovih bakterij Na vidminu vid svoyih rodichiv rizobij sho ye simbiontami roslin cya bakteriya ye vidomim patogenom bagatoh vidiv roslin viklikayuchi hvorobu koronchastih galliv tipu roslinnoyi puhlini Cherez velike chislo vidiv roslin yaki vona vrazhaye napriklad vinograd hrin cukrovij buryak revin ye vazhlivoyu zagrozoyu dlya silskogo gospodarstva 1 Krim togo vona mozhe buti oportunistichnim patogenom deyakih tvarin zokrema lyudini 2 Golovnij faktorom patogennosti ye zdatnist ciyeyi bakteriyi transformuvati klitini roslini hazyayina za dopomogoyu specialnoyi plazmidi Cherez cyu vlastivist Agrobacterium tumefaciens shiroko vikoristovuyetsya v gennij inzheneriyi dlya transformaciyi roslin Zmist 1 Sistematika 2 Biologichni vlastivosti 2 1 tumefaciens yakij buv bi legitimnim pri perenesenni bakteriyi do inshogo rodu 5 prote propoziciya ne bula prijnyata Biologichni vlastivosti RedaguvatiMorfologiya Redaguvati Agrobacterium tumefaciens pryami abo zlegka zignuti palichkopodibni bakteriyi rozmirom 0 6 1 0 1 5 3 0 mikron Ne utvoryuyut spor ruhomi za dopomogoyu 1 4 dzhgutikiv roztashovanih peritrihialno odinochno abo poparno Metabolizm Redaguvati Cya bakteriya hemoorganogeterotrof obligatnij aerob Ne vimagaye specifichnih faktoriv dlya zrostannya na shtuchnih pozhivnih seredovishah Zdatna vikoristovuvati vidnosno velikij spektr organichnih rechovin yak yedine dzherelo vuglecyu N acetilglyukozamin a alanin b alanin arabinozu aspartat dulcit tosho zdatnij rosti v LB buljoni Na agarizovanih pozhivnih seredovishah utvoryuyut opukli krugli gladki koloniyi sho ne pigmentuyutsya abo slabo bezhevi Utilizuvye mannitol ta inshi vuglevodi z utvorennyam kisloti Na seredovishah z vuglevodami sposterigayetsya vidilennya slizu ekzopolisaharidiv Oksidazopozitivni utvoryuyut ureazu ne utvoryuyut indol 6 Genom Redaguvati Genom A tumefaciens shtamu S58 maye rozmir 5 67 mln par osnov i skladayetsya z dvoh hromosom kilceioyi i linijnoyi 7 i dvi plazmidi Vidmichenij velikij riven gomologiyi z genomom Sinorhizobium meliloti sho pripuskaye nedavnye evolyucijne rozhodzhennya 8 Kilceva hromosoma A tumefaciens shtamu S58 maye rozmir 2841580 par osnov i mistit 2819 geniv z yakih 2765 koduyut bilki 9 Linijna hromosoma maye rozmir 2075577 par osnov i mistit 1884 geniv z yakih 1851 koduyut bilki 10 Nayavnist kilcevoyi i linijnoyi hromosomi harakterna i dlya inshih shtamiv A tumefaciens napriklad shtamu MAFF301001 8 nbsp Mapa Ti plazmidi A tumefaciensA tumefaciens shtamu S58 mistit dva plazmidi At plazmidu i Ti plazmidu At plazmida vid Agrobacterium tumefaciens ye kilcevoyu dvolancyuzhkovoyu molekuloyu DNK rozmirom 542868 par osnov i mistit 557 geniv z yakih 542 koduyut bilki 11 Ti plazmida vid angl tumor inducing obumovlyuye patogennist A tumefaciens i zdatna vbudovuvatisya v genom roslini gospodarya perenosyachi T DNK v procesi sajt specifichnoyi rekombinaciyi 12 13 plazmida takozh mozhe chastkovo vbudovuvatisya v genom Saccharomyces cerevisiae shlyahom nezakonnoyi rekombinaciyi 14 Prote zarazhennya mishej patogennimi A tumefaciens ne viklikaye ekspresiyi geniv reporteriv v tkaninah 15 Ti plazmida A tumefaciens shtamu S58 ye kilcevoyu dvolancyugovoyu molekuloyu DNK rozmirom 214233 par osnov i mistit 199 geniv z yakih 197 koduyut bilki 16 Cya plazmida mistit geni sho kontrolyuyut biosintez i katabolizm specifichnih aminokislot opiniv 17 sho vikoristovuyutsya yak dzherelo zhivlennya ciyeyi bakteriyi oktopin nopalin agropin 18 geni virulentnosti geni sintezu fitogormoniv citokininiv i auksiniv yaki viklikayut utvorennya puhlin i dediferenciyuvannya tkanin roslini T DNK vlasne i ye integrovanoyu dilyankoyu Ti plazmidi sho nese geni sintezu fitogormonov i opiniv 19 Patogennist dlya roslin Redaguvati nbsp Koronchasti galli utvoreni A tumefaciens na korinni Carya illinoensisA tumefaciens viklikaye utvorennya tak zvanih koronchatih galliv u roslin Ce puhlinoutvorennya pov yazane z perenesennyam T DNK v genom roslini z podalshoyu jogo transformaciyeyu Transformovani klini zvazhayuchi na disbalans sintezu fitogormonov dediferencuyutsya i pochinayut nevregulovane zrostannya Takozh transformovani klitini roslini pochinayut sintezuvati opini yaki A tumefaciens zdatna vikoristovuvati yak dzherelo zhivlennya Pevnu rol v indukciyi ekspresiyi geniv virulentnosti A tumefaciens z roslinoyu gospodarem grayut specifichni vnutriklitinni metaboliti roslini hazyayina 20 sho vidilyayutsya pri poranenni tkanin roslini 21 Vazhlivim etapom patogennogo procesu ye sintez T vorsinok pri dopomozi sistemi sekreciyi IV tipu sho zdijsnyuyetsya pid diyeyu VIRB operonu Za dopomogoyu T vorsinok A tumefaciens priyednuyetsya do klitini roslini formuyuchi kon yugacijnij mistok i za dopomogoyu bilka VirE1 perenosit kompleks odnolancyuzhkovoyi T DNK z bilkom VirE2 22 sho utvoryuyetsya zazdalegid z Ti plazmidi i spoluchenogo z bilkom VirE2 23 v klitinu roslini 24 25 Takozh na transformaciyu klitin roslin robit vpliv specifichnij bilok VirE3 sho transportuyetsya v yadro razom z T DNK i sho jmovirno zv yazuyetsya z faktorom transkripciyi 26 U yadri T DNK integruyetsya v genom klitini roslini hazyayina 27 shlyahom sajt specifichnoyi rekombinaciyi 28 29 Vprovadzhennya T DNK viklikaye utvorennya harakternih puhlin roslin cherez gipersintez fitogormoniv u puhlinnih tkaninah pochinayut nakopichuvatisya opini Podibnij proces vlastivij inshomu vidu rodu A rhizogenes sho takozh mistit Ti plazmidu Vikoristannya v gennij inzheneriyi Redaguvati nbsp S chacoense en transformovani za dopomogoyu A tumefaciens Shmatochki listka v yakih rozpochalosya kalusoutvorennyaZavdyaki zdatnosti A tumefaciens transformuvati klitini roslin cya bakteriya zaraz aktivno vikoristovuyetsya dlya perenesennya genetichnogo materialu z metoyu genetichnoyi modifikaciyi roslin 30 31 A tumefaciens zdatna transformuvati bilshist dvodolnih roslin 32 33 tak i deyaki odnodolni 34 35 ta deyaki mikroskopichni gribki 36 Na osnovi Ti plazmidi buli rozrobleni specifichni vektori z vidalenimi genami fitogormoniv i opiniv dlya togo shob perenositi chuzhoridnu genetichnu informaciyi do genomu roslin 37 z metoyu otrimannya roslin z bazhanimi korisnimi oznakami Div takozh RedaguvatiAcetosiringonPrimitki Redaguvati Moore LW Chilton WS Canfield ML 1997
